    Chile Pumped Storage Power Station

    Chile's Valhalla Energy plans to harness the country's remarkable geography to make clean power by pumping seawater up into mountains during the day and releasing it at night.


    FAQs about Chile Pumped Storage Power Station

    What is the Chilean hydro project?

    The project, which will be built at an unspecified location in Chile's Andes region, will combine a pumped hydro storage station that uses saltwater with a desalination system to be powered by wind and solar.

    Which Chilean hydropower plant will use solar power?

    “Situated in the coastal area of Caleta San Marcos, 100km south of Iquique, it will be the first Chilean hydropower plant to use solar power to perform operations.” An environmental assessment has been performed by Valhalla and the environmental impact study (EIA) for the project has been approved.

    Will Valhalla be a partner with Chile's energy goals?

    Valhalla is currently in the process of inviting strategic investors to participate as partners in the ownership of the project. Valhalla's innovative project is compatible with Chile's energy goals.

    Which pumped storage facility in Ireland has 292 MW?

    The Irish Minister for Communications, Energy and Natural Resources reported to the Oireachtas on 15 January 2014 "... in Ireland we have the Turlough Hill pumped storage facility in County Wicklow, which has a capacity of 292 MW.

    Is Turlough Hill Ireland's only pumped-storage hydroelectricity plant?

    Turlough Hill (292 MW), operated by the ESB, is currently Ireland's only pumped-storage hydroelectricity plant. However, this is likely to change shortly and ECOFACT have worked on a number of these schemes currently being progressed in Ireland.

    How many pumped storage hydropower facilities are there in Wicklow?

    There is currently only one pumped storage hydropower facility, Turlough Hill, in County Wicklow. This facility, operated by the ESB, currently has the ability to go from idle to full power in the space of just 70 seconds, and its four turbines can generate in the region of 300MW of electricity.

    Will Ireland develop more pumped storage hydroelectric capacity by 2030?

    Ireland could develop an additional 360MW of pumped storage hydroelectric capacity by 2030 to mitigate security of supply concerns in relation to electricity.
